Ireland’s sovereign credit rating lowered by Standard & Poor’s for the second time in 2009; Move triggered by Anglo Irish losses and NAMA

Ireland's sovereign credit rating was lowered for the second time in 2009, today by by Standard & Poor’s, which cited the rising cost of bailing out the country's banks.
